Output 7ba8bbf195dd54fb72f66a65a900d2024ef5d5fbb5fcd935267aadd47bd632c7:25

value
86429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9515475f3d519c527af2238c1a9c56e8bc2d7d OP_EQUAL
address
3MoMBDuEe68DSiBvM9S438E8w4hdj9c5y2
transaction
7ba8bbf195dd54fb72f66a65a900d2024ef5d5fbb5fcd935267aadd47bd632c7
confirmations
10538
spent
true